Japanese meaning of ムズムズ

Reading:
むずむず (muzumuzu)

English Translation:

restless, itching to act

Scene & Cultural Context

Cultural Context:


Used in love scenes for "itching" to confess or when the mood is awkwardly sweet.

Grammar & Learning Points

Grammar Point

Used as “ムズムズする” (“to feel restless or fidgety”).

Example

Basic Example

好きと言えなくてムズムズする。

I’m itching to say I like her.


Applied Example

近づくたびムズムズ…恋の予感。

I get restless every time I see her.
